Navarre architect Fernando Redón dies at 87 years of age

The architect Fernando Redón passed away at the age of 87, after a long and exemplary career as an architect involved in the incorporation of the ideals of Modern Architecture into his environment, which allows him to be considered the author of some of the best works of architecture in Navarre and the Basque Country, both alone and in partnership with Javier Guibert Tabar.

Fernando Redón, who was a professor at the School of Architecture He has successfully combined his work as a designer with that of a designer, photographer (award international "Nikon 1975"), disseminator of the monumental and natural heritage of Navarre and cultural manager, among others.

The School's director , Miguel Ángel Alonso del Val, pointed out that he gave the profession of architect "the relevance that only humanists with a wide range of experience can give. All of this with a quality staff and a high level of vision that earned him the award of award Príncipe de Viana de la Cultura 2004".

"Fernando Redón will always remain in the memory of our School as a gentleman full of generosity and good humor, wise and close, as a personality of our profession that, by trajectory and disposition, represents the most worthy and meritorious of it, in a quiet and peripheral work that has served as an example and has borne fruit in the extraordinary quality of the young Spanish architecture that, in Navarre and beyond, he has always protected and sponsored", he has assured.
